AXAS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

170 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Abraxas Petroleum Corp (AXAS)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$289M — up 48% from $196M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 33 funds opened new AXAS positions and 12 closed out — a net gain of 21 holders — while 61 added to existing stakes and 43 trimmed.

The largest buyer was State Street, adding an estimated $5.43M. The largest seller was Portolan Capital Management, cutting an estimated $5.13M.
